Becoming an electrician in Waterbury, CT, typically starts with an apprenticeship, which combines hands-on experience with classroom learning, allowing individuals to earn while they learn. Apprenticeships last about four to five years, requiring many hours of training under licensed professionals. According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, there are approximately 3,200 electricians in Connecticut, with wages averaging $1,342.50 per week in Q1 2024 and $1,431 per week in Q2 2024. This strong earning potential often exceeds $108,000 annually for experienced professionals, making it a lucrative career choice. Trade schools, unions, and platforms like Gild help aspiring electricians in Waterbury find apprenticeship opportunities, leading to a promising future in the electrical trade.

Under the direction of the Electrician Supervisor, perform the work at the Journeyman level to install, operate, repair electrical equipment in substations, power stations at voltages from 120/240 up to 345Kv and customer installations within the State of Connecticut. The physical demands of this position range from LIGHT to HEAVY; these include but are not limited to: operating aerial lifts, cranes, lulls, welding and cutting steel and aluminum. Testing, calibrating and maintaining controls, meters, relays, and switches. Installation of equipment and maintenance of transformers, capacitors, transducers, re-closers, reactors breakers, control panels, relays and bus as well as troubleshoot wiring circuits, voltage regulators, and other electronic equipment. These are completed in accordance with all applicable OSHA regulations, distribution construction standards, and established schedules and safety procedures at Eversource. Standing, walking, lifting, carrying, and reaching are performed on a frequent basis. Bending, pushing, pulling, climbing, kneeling, and twisting are performed on an occasional to frequent basis. The heaviest physical demands are required during the moving and handling of 55-gallon drums, capacitor cans, re-closer control boxes, bushings, and nitrogen tanks. These activities require handling of up to 25-pounds on a frequent basis, 50-100 pounds on an occasional basis. Heavier tasks may require the assistance of (2) or more co-workers.
